The international identity of the mobile team – or IMEI – is a unique numerical identifier for each mobile device. You may have heard that your insurance company or police encourage you to register your IMEI.

The IMEI number is on the silver sticker on the back of your phone, under the battery or in the box into which your phone was entered.
